Las Vegas is renowned for its dazzling lights and world-class dining, but beyond the famous Strip, a powerful annual event combines culinary excellence with community impact: Las Vegas Restaurant Week. This beloved initiative, now in its 18th year, transforms dining out into an act of giving back, channeling vital support to Three Square Food Bank, Southern Nevada’s largest hunger relief organization. From June 2 to June 13, 2025, locals and visitors have the unique opportunity to savor specially curated prix fixe menus at exceptional value, knowing that each meal contributes to fighting food insecurity in the community. Discover the diverse and delicious offerings from the vibrant off-strip dining scene, participating in this meaningful Las Vegas food event.
A Legacy of Giving: The Impact of Three Square Food Bank
Las Vegas Restaurant Week’s enduring success is intrinsically linked to its partnership with Three Square Food Bank. Since its inception, the event has served as a crucial fundraising platform, allowing restaurants to leverage their culinary talents for the greater good. Three Square works tirelessly to provide wholesome food to hungry people, and its efforts significantly reduce hunger in the region. By dining at participating establishments during Restaurant Week, guests directly support Three Square’s mission, making a tangible difference in the lives of those in need across Southern Nevada.

Triple George Grill: A Delicious Restaurant Week Experience
Triple George Grill is participating in Restaurant Week with an enticing three-course dinner menu priced at $80. Guests can begin their meal with a choice of Tuna Tiradito, Pork Belly Steak, Half Dozen Oysters, or a Lil Caesar Salad. For the main course, selections include a 10oz New York Strip Steak, Seared Salmon, or Roasted Eggplant. The meal concludes with a delightful dessert choice of House Tiramisu or Brulé Cheese Cake, offering a refined dining experience.

Savor a Slice for a Cause at Evel Pie
Starting Restaurant Week from June 2 to 13th, Evel Pie is introducing a new, limited-time pizza called the “Summertime Madness Pie.” This unique creation is a collaboration with former NFL cornerback and Next Level Chef contestant Mark McMillian, incorporating his special Grillin’ McMillian BBQ Sauce. The pie features mesquite olive oil, mozzarella cheese, BBQ brisket, hot honey sausage, and McMillian’s signature sauce. Slices are available for $7 each, with $1 from every slice directly benefiting Three Square Food Bank to help fight food insecurity in Southern Nevada.
